Hi there! I recently bought a GTI MK5 in mid October 2019 to be exact. I'm based in Lesotho so it's an import model from Japan. On arrival it already had 'Service Now' on the cluster. I did a minor service on the car on the second day in my possession and subsequently cleared the notification. A month later the 'Service Now' notification appeared again-I assumed I must change the DSG oil. Did buy the OEM gearbox oil at Volkswagen Bethlehem and changed. Again cleared the notification after the DSG oil change, however to my disbelief the notification came up again, what could be the cause now?. The car performance is tops.

Our answer:

Hi Seth,

If that light is activated by an oil quality sensor then perhaps the sensor itself is at fault. Best to get the car along to a good mechanic to have it looked at.
